Here they are – the tourism businesses at the top of their game.
Finalists in the Visit York Tourism Awards 2019 were revealed today (Thursday 4 April), during English Tourism Week.
The 57 businesses will go head to head to win one of 16 trophies, and be named best in York.
The prestigious awards will return on Thursday 20 June to shine a spotlight on excellence in York’s tourism sector and reward outstanding service, innovation and quality.
The event is a fantastic platform to showcase tourism businesses to a 450 strong audience from across York’s tourism sector. There are 16 categories, including two new ones: Tourism Supplier of the Year and Innovation in Tourism.
These prestigious ‘Tourism Oscars of the North’, sponsored by LNER will be compered by Minster FM Breakfast Presenter Ben Fry and held in the Great Hall of the National Railway Museum, where guests will rub shoulders with railway legends, from history-makers to record-breakers.

Tourism Champion 2019
To be revealed at the awards ceremony
The Tourism Champion award category is in recognition of an individual who has made an outstanding contribution to York’s Tourism Industry. The winner will be revealed on the night.
